WebI always wash all my clothes together and never had any problems. The exception is new dark coloured stuff where the dye could run, so wash your new black jeans or red top with similar colours or even separately. If you have any delicate stuff I'd either hand wash it or put it in separate delicates wash if you can, or put it in a delicates bag. 9. WebJun 22, 2024 · Yes, It is possible to wash most jeans with other clothes of the same colors or dark-colored clothes. Some manufacturers recommend washing your jeans separately. This is because the dye used in denim can bleed into other garments if you put them in the machine together.
